Acquisition Information Purchased, 1996 Biography / Administrative History Barbara Carrasco is a painter and muralist in whose work has been important in the development of art, U.S. contemporary political and public art, and women's cultural production. Her art has been collected in the Library of Congress and the Smithsonian Institution. Between 1976 and 1991, Carrasco worked closely with Cesar Chavez and the (UFW), producing graphic arts, banners, and murals that were an integral part of the union's activities. In the early 1980's, Carrasco was at the center of an intense battle over artistics censorship with the Community Redevelopment Agency of the City of Los Angeles, which refused to exhibit her portable mural "L.A. History -- A Mexican Perspective". Carrasco's other murals include the centerpiece for 's play, (1978), and a computer animation "mural" on pesticides displayed on the big screen monitor in Times Square.
